Abstract

The purpose of this research is to study the cognitive preference of the old people in the color matching of assistive products. First of all, the elderly assistive products color matching was analyzed. Based on this point, the double color samples color matching software was designed, and there are 858 valid two Color harmony pictures were obtained. Secondly, there were 50 pairs of Kansei words were obtained through investigation and research. Using Multidimensional scaling method and Clustering analysis method, there were 5 pairs of representative Kansei words were extracted: Emotional-rational, Traditional-modern, Natural-technological, Massive-leggiere”, Rigid-soft. According to above, were aimed to give score to 20 subjects(Contains the elderly group and young group)through the E-prime software, using the Likert scale to grade 858 valid two Color harmony pictures. The perceptual evaluation value of 5 pairs of representative Kansei words with 858 valid two Color harmony pictures were obtained. Finally, the different cognitive preference of double color matching for assistive products of the old people was obtained through the statistical analysis. The results can not only provide reasonable color recommendations, but also shorten the production cycle.
